Output 2135bf3fc1d6c2fabdf5c468561339cb45f3ab718e49138cdf580c6c7eb12a56:8

value
17770433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f470db3e63453737e3c5430b8e2eb988f7834b OP_EQUAL
address
MRfz9h9RvcShpeBafebdbNgszc6ZcSHMZj
transaction
2135bf3fc1d6c2fabdf5c468561339cb45f3ab718e49138cdf580c6c7eb12a56
spent
true